Are you frustrated with Avast Antivirus consuming all your CPU resources, leaving your system slow and unresponsive? You’re not alone! Many users have reported this issue, and it’s essential to understand the reasons behind it. In this article, we’ll delve into the possible causes of Avast’s CPU usage and provide you with actionable solutions to optimize your system’s performance.
What’s Causing Avast to Consume So Much CPU?
Before we dive into the solutions, let’s explore the possible reasons why Avast might be using all your CPU:
1. Malware Scanning and Detection
Avast’s primary function is to protect your system from malware, viruses, and other threats. To achieve this, it continuously scans your system, files, and online activities for potential dangers. This process can be resource-intensive, especially if you have a large number of files or a slow system. Avast’s scanning engine might be causing high CPU usage, especially during:
- Initial system scans
- Scheduled scans
- Real-time protection
- Mail scanning
- Web shields
i. Initial System Scans
When you first install Avast, it performs an initial system scan to detect and remove any existing malware. This process can be CPU-intensive, but it’s a one-time operation.
ii. Scheduled Scans
Avast allows you to schedule scans at regular intervals, which can cause high CPU usage during the scanning process.
iii. Real-Time Protection
Avast’s real-time protection feature continuously monitors your system for malware and viruses, which can lead to increased CPU usage.
iv. Mail Scanning
If you use Avast’s email scanning feature, it might consume more CPU resources, especially if you receive a large number of emails.
v. Web Shields
Avast’s web shields scan web pages and online traffic for malware, which can cause high CPU usage, especially if you have multiple browser tabs open.
2. Program Updates and Definitions
Avast regularly releases updates and new virus definitions to stay ahead of emerging threats. These updates can cause temporary spikes in CPU usage as Avast downloads and installs new files.
3. Background Processes
Avast runs several background processes to maintain its services and features, including:
- AvastSvc.exe (main service process)
- AvastUI.exe (user interface process)
- aswidsagenta.exe (Windows process)
- aswidsagenta64.exe (Windows process for 64-bit systems)
These processes can contribute to high CPU usage, especially if they’re not optimized or are conflicting with other system processes.
4. Incompatible Software or Hardware
In some cases, Avast might not be compatible with certain software or hardware, leading to high CPU usage or system crashes. This could be due to:
- Conflicting antivirus software
- Outdated drivers or firmware
- Incompatible system configurations
5. Resource-Intensive Features
Avast offers various features that can consume significant CPU resources, including:
- Wi-Fi scanning
- Password management
- Performance optimization tools
- Browser extensions
How to Optimize Avast’s CPU Usage
Now that we’ve explored the possible reasons behind Avast’s high CPU usage, let’s discuss some solutions to optimize its performance:
1. Adjust Avast’s Settings
Avast provides various settings to customize its behavior and reduce CPU usage:
- Adjust scan settings: Lower the scan sensitivity or exclude certain files and folders from scans.
- Disable unnecessary features: Turn off features like Wi-Fi scanning, password management, or performance optimization tools if you don’t need them.
- Schedule scans wisely: Schedule scans during times when you’re not actively using your system, like overnight or during lunch breaks.
2. Update Avast and Operating System
Ensure that Avast and your operating system are up-to-date, as newer versions often include performance optimizations and bug fixes:
- Update Avast: Regularly update Avast to the latest version to take advantage of performance improvements and new features.
- Update your operating system: Keep your operating system updated to ensure you have the latest security patches and performance enhancements.
3. Disable Unnecessary Background Processes
Close or disable unnecessary Avast background processes to free up CPU resources:
- Task Manager: Open Task Manager and sort the processes by CPU usage. If you find any Avast-related processes consuming high CPU, close them or set them to run at a lower priority.
- MSConfig: Use MSConfig to disable Avast-related startup programs and services.
4. Check for Conflicting Software or Hardware
Identify and resolve any conflicts with other software or hardware:
- Uninstall conflicting software: Remove any antivirus software that might be conflicting with Avast.
- Update drivers and firmware: Ensure that your system drivers and firmware are up-to-date to prevent compatibility issues.
5. Consider Alternative Antivirus Solutions
If Avast continues to consume excessive CPU resources despite optimization, you may want to consider alternative antivirus solutions that are more lightweight and efficient:
- Free antivirus alternatives: Explore free antivirus options like Microsoft Defender, Avira, or Kaspersky.
- Paid antivirus alternatives: Consider paid antivirus solutions like Norton Antivirus, McAfee, or Bitdefender.
Conclusion
Avast’s high CPU usage can be frustrating, but by understanding the causes and implementing the solutions outlined above, you can optimize your system’s performance and enjoy a smoother user experience. Remember to regularly update Avast and your operating system, adjust settings to suit your needs, and consider alternative antivirus solutions if necessary.
What is Avast CPU Hog and how does it affect my computer?
Avast CPU Hog refers to a situation where the Avast antivirus software consumes an abnormally high amount of CPU resources, causing a significant slowdown in system performance. This can lead to frustrating issues like freezing, lagging, and even system crashes. As a result, it’s essential to identify and address the underlying reasons behind the resource drain to ensure a smooth and secure computing experience.
The impact of Avast CPU Hog can be far-reaching, affecting not only the performance of your computer but also your productivity and overall user experience. For instance, if you’re a gamer, you may experience lagging or stuttering during gameplay, while video editors and content creators may notice slower rendering times or freezes. Moreover, if left unchecked, the excessive CPU usage can even lead to overheating, which can reduce the lifespan of your computer’s components.
Why does Avast consume high CPU resources?
Avast’s high CPU consumption can be attributed to various factors, including its aggressive scanning and monitoring activities, outdated software, conflicts with other programs, and even malware infections. When Avast detects suspicious activity or malware, it may engage in intense scanning and cleaning processes, which can temporarily spike CPU usage. Additionally, if Avast is not updated regularly, it may not be equipped to handle modern threats efficiently, leading to increased resource utilization.
Furthermore, Avast may also consume high CPU resources due to conflicts with other resource-intensive programs or system processes. For example, if you’re running multiple antivirus software simultaneously, they may clash and cause CPU spikes. Similarly, if your system is infected with malware, Avast may struggle to remove the threat, leading to increased CPU usage.
How can I check if Avast is consuming high CPU resources?
To check if Avast is consuming high CPU resources, you can use the Task Manager on Windows or Activity Monitor on macOS. Simply press the Ctrl + Shift + Esc keys (Windows) or Command + Option + Esc keys (macOS) to open the Task Manager or Activity Monitor, and then sort the processes by CPU usage. If you notice that Avast is consistently using high CPU resources, it’s likely that there’s an underlying issue that needs to be addressed.
In addition to using system tools, you can also monitor Avast’s performance from within the software itself. Avast provides features like the Performance Center, which offers insights into system resource utilization and suggests optimizations to improve performance. By regularly checking these metrics, you can identify potential issues and take corrective action before they escalate.
How can I reduce Avast’s CPU consumption?
To reduce Avast’s CPU consumption, you can try several troubleshooting steps, including updating Avast to the latest version, adjusting the software’s settings, and excluding certain files or folders from scanning. You can also try disabling unnecessary features or add-ons, such as the Wi-Fi Scanner or Password Manager, to reduce the load on your system.
Additionally, you can also consider tweaking Avast’s scheduling options to avoid overlapping scans or reducing the frequency of updates. By fine-tuning Avast’s settings and optimizing its performance, you can minimize its impact on system resources and ensure a smoother computing experience.
Will disabling Avast resolve the CPU hog issue?
Disabling Avast may provide temporary relief from the CPU hog issue, but it’s not a recommended long-term solution. Avast is an essential security component that protects your system from malware and other threats. By disabling it, you may expose your system to potential risks, including data breaches and system compromise.
Instead, it’s recommended to identify and address the underlying causes of the CPU hog issue. This may involve updating Avast, adjusting its settings, or resolving conflicts with other system processes. By taking a targeted approach to troubleshooting, you can ensure that your system remains secure while minimizing the performance impact.
Can I use other antivirus software to avoid the CPU hog issue?
While it’s possible to switch to alternative antivirus software, it’s essential to note that every security solution has its strengths and weaknesses. Some antivirus software may be more resource-intensive than others, while others may offer better performance at the cost of reduced security features.
Before making a switch, it’s crucial to evaluate your specific needs and ensure that the alternative software provides adequate protection for your system. You may also want to consider factors like user interface, features, and pricing before making an informed decision.
How can I prevent future CPU hog issues with Avast?
To prevent future CPU hog issues with Avast, it’s essential to maintain your system and Avast software regularly. This includes keeping your operating system and Avast up-to-date, ensuring that you have the latest virus definitions, and regularly scanning your system for malware.
Additionally, you can also take proactive steps to prevent malware infections, such as avoiding suspicious downloads, being cautious when clicking on links or opening email attachments, and using strong passwords. By adopting a comprehensive approach to system maintenance and security, you can minimize the risk of CPU hog issues and ensure a secure and performing system.